I also saw these stamps from Germany.  The company is LaBlanche and this is the first time these stamps have been available.  They’ve been in business for 10 years but have only been sold on UK and German home shopping networks.  They are very detailed and are mounted on foam blocks that have a hard plastic coating on both sides.

LeBlanche 1

For me, these are those type of images that look good stamped in black or brown and then done with a light color wash.  I would think that some of the main images in them would also look good colored with Copics.
